
Wall Dances Sacred Dances in Bali
Wali dances or Sacred dances are planned to be registered by Bali Provincial Government to the world institution of educational and cultural department known as UNESCO. Wali dances or Sacred dances mentioned here are dances that are used by Balinese at religious ceremonies.
Institute Seni Indonesia (ISI) Denpasar and professional staff from Ministry of Tourism and Cultural Affair are involved in the classification and identification process.
Head of Bali Cultural Agency, Ida Bagus Sedhawa conveyed that Wali dances would be directly registered with the Unesco after the identification and classification process is completed. The aim of this registry for Balinese dances with the UNESCO would see no country ever claiming those dances anymore.
